位置:excel百科网-关于excel知识普及与知识讲解 > 资讯中心 > excel问答 > 文章详情

excel为什么会变成手动计算

作者:excel百科网
|
294人看过
发布时间:2026-01-23 00:11:29
标签:
Excel为什么会变成手动计算?深度解析其背后的技术逻辑与使用局限在Excel中,我们常常会遇到一种现象:当你在公式中输入计算公式后,Excel会自动进行计算,但有时却会显示“手动计算”字样。这种现象背后隐藏着Excel在计算方式上的
excel为什么会变成手动计算
Excel为什么会变成手动计算?深度解析其背后的技术逻辑与使用局限
在Excel中,我们常常会遇到一种现象:当你在公式中输入计算公式后,Excel会自动进行计算,但有时却会显示“手动计算”字样。这种现象背后隐藏着Excel在计算方式上的一些技术逻辑与使用习惯。本文将从Excel的计算模式、数据处理流程、用户操作习惯等多个角度,深入剖析为何Excel会变成手动计算,并探讨其背后的原理与影响。
一、Excel的计算模式演变
Excel的计算模式经历了从“公式计算”到“手动计算”的转变,这一过程并非一蹴而就,而是随着技术发展与使用场景的演变逐步形成的。在Excel早期版本中,用户主要通过公式进行数据处理,其计算模式是自动计算的,即Excel在每次输入公式后,自动根据数据变化重新计算整个公式。这种模式极大地提高了数据处理的效率,也使得Excel成为商业和办公场景中不可或缺的工具。
然而,随着Excel功能的不断扩展,尤其是公式复杂度的提升,Excel的自动计算模式逐渐暴露出一些局限性。例如,当公式中涉及大量嵌套或引用多个单元格时,计算速度会显著下降,甚至在某些情况下导致计算停滞或错误。此外,Excel在处理大量数据时,计算资源消耗较大,影响了性能。因此,为了提升计算效率和稳定性,Excel引入了手动计算模式。
二、手动计算的定义与作用
手动计算是指Excel在进行计算时,不自动重新计算所有公式,而是只对受变化影响的单元格进行重新计算。这种模式在某些特定场景下非常有用,比如:
1. 公式中仅涉及少量单元格的计算:当公式仅引用少量单元格时,Excel可以快速进行手动计算,无需重新计算整个公式。
2. 用户希望控制计算过程:某些用户可能希望在计算过程中手动干预,比如在计算前调整数据,或在计算后进行数据验证。
3. 优化性能:在处理大量数据时,手动计算可以减少计算资源的消耗,提升整体效率。
手动计算模式虽然不如自动计算高效,但在特定场景下仍具有不可替代的价值。
三、Excel自动计算的机制
Excel的自动计算机制是其核心功能之一,它基于公式引擎数据依赖图来实现计算。其工作原理如下:
1. 公式引擎:Excel内部使用公式引擎来解析和执行用户输入的公式。当用户在单元格中输入公式后,公式引擎会将其解析为可执行的计算指令。
2. 数据依赖图:Excel会构建一个数据依赖图,记录每个单元格与其他单元格之间的依赖关系。当某个单元格的数据发生变化时,Excel会根据依赖图重新计算相关单元格。
3. 计算策略:Excel在每次数据变化后,会根据依赖图的结构,逐个重新计算受影响的单元格,从而实现自动计算。
这种机制使得Excel在处理复杂公式时具备高度的灵活性和准确性,但也带来了性能上的挑战。
四、手动计算的实现方式
手动计算是Excel在特定情况下采用的一种计算模式,其实现方式主要有以下几种:
1. 手动触发计算:用户可以点击“计算单元格”按钮,或按快捷键(如 `Alt + F9`)来手动触发计算。这种方式适用于公式中仅涉及少量单元格的情况。
2. 公式中包含“手动计算”选项:在Excel中,用户可以通过设置选项,将某些公式设为“手动计算”。这种设置在公式中使用时,会限制Excel重新计算所有公式,仅对受影响的单元格进行计算。
3. 使用“计算模式”选项:Excel提供“计算模式”选项,用户可以选择“自动”、“手动”或“加粗”三种模式。其中,“手动”模式下,Excel不自动重新计算所有公式,仅对受影响的单元格进行计算。
手动计算模式在处理复杂公式时,可以显著提升性能,但也需要用户具备一定的计算控制能力。
五、手动计算的优缺点比较
优点:
1. 提升性能:手动计算可以减少计算资源的消耗,尤其是在处理大量数据时,能够显著提高效率。
2. 控制计算过程:用户可以手动干预计算过程,避免自动计算带来的潜在错误。
3. 适用于特定场景:在公式中仅涉及少量单元格的情况下,手动计算可以提高计算速度。
缺点:
1. 计算效率低:手动计算不涉及自动重新计算整个公式,因此在处理复杂公式时效率较低。
2. 需要用户干预:用户需要手动触发计算,增加了操作的复杂性。
3. 无法自动更新数据:在数据变化后,手动计算不会自动更新相关单元格,需要用户手动重新计算。
六、手动计算的适用场景
手动计算模式适用于以下几种情况:
1. 公式中仅涉及少量单元格:例如,用户在计算某个特定值时,仅需对几个单元格进行计算。
2. 数据量较小:在处理少量数据时,手动计算可以快速完成计算任务。
3. 用户希望控制计算过程:在某些特定操作中,用户希望在计算前调整数据,或在计算后进行数据验证。
4. 数据依赖关系简单:当公式中数据依赖关系简单,仅涉及少量单元格时,手动计算可以提高效率。
七、Excel自动计算与手动计算的对比分析
| 对比维度 | 自动计算 | 手动计算 |
|-|-|-|
| 计算方式 | 全部重新计算 | 受影响单元格重新计算 |
| 计算效率 | 高 | 低 |
| 数据依赖 | 复杂 | 简单 |
| 用户操作 | 自动 | 需要手动干预 |
| 适用场景 | 复杂公式 | 少量数据或特定场景 |
自动计算模式在处理复杂公式时表现优异,而手动计算模式在处理少量数据或特定场景时更具优势。
八、Excel手动计算的使用建议
在实际使用Excel时,用户可以根据具体情况选择自动计算或手动计算模式。以下是一些建议:
1. 在公式中仅涉及少量单元格时,使用手动计算模式,以提高效率。
2. 在处理大量数据时,使用自动计算模式,以确保计算的准确性和效率。
3. 在需要手动干预计算的场景,如数据调整或计算验证时,使用手动计算模式。
4. 在数据依赖关系复杂时,使用自动计算模式,以确保计算的全面性和准确性。
九、手动计算的未来趋势与发展方向
随着Excel功能的不断扩展,手动计算模式也逐渐被更先进的计算模式所取代。未来,Excel可能会引入智能计算基于人工智能的自动计算,以进一步提升计算效率和准确性。
此外,随着云计算和大数据技术的发展,Excel在处理大规模数据时,可能会采用更高效的计算模式,以适应现代办公环境的需求。
十、总结
Excel的计算模式从“自动计算”到“手动计算”,是技术发展和使用需求共同作用的结果。自动计算模式在复杂公式中表现优异,但手动计算模式在特定场景下具有不可替代的优势。用户应根据实际需求选择合适的计算模式,以提高效率和准确性。
在Excel的使用过程中,理解计算模式的变化不仅有助于提升工作效率,也能够帮助用户更好地掌握这一工具的使用技巧。无论是公式复杂还是数据量庞大,合理选择计算模式,都能让Excel发挥出最大的价值。
:Excel的计算模式演变反映了技术进步与用户需求的互动,手动计算虽不如有自动计算高效,但在特定场景下仍具有重要意义。理解这些计算模式,有助于我们在实际工作中更有效地使用Excel,提升工作效率与数据处理能力。
推荐文章
相关文章
推荐URL
为什么有时Excel复制不完全?在日常工作中,Excel作为一款广泛使用的电子表格工具,被大量应用于数据处理、报表生成、财务分析等场景。然而,许多用户在复制数据时可能会遇到“复制不完全”的问题,这往往让人感到困惑甚至挫败。本文将深入探
2026-01-23 00:11:28
240人看过
为什么Excel全部功能菜单是灰色?深度解析与实用建议在使用Excel的过程中,用户常常会遇到一个令人困惑的现象:所有功能菜单都显示为灰色。这种现象看似简单,实则背后涉及Excel的多种机制与用户操作习惯。本文将从技术原理、用
2026-01-23 00:11:06
62人看过
为什么Excel表格无法求和?深度解析与解决方案在日常办公与数据处理中,Excel表格因其强大的功能和便捷的操作方式,成为数据管理的首选工具。然而,对于一些用户来说,却常常遇到“为什么Excel表格无法求和”的困惑。本文将从多个角度深
2026-01-23 00:10:43
237人看过
面积图除了Excel还能用什么?深度解析实用工具与方法在数据可视化领域,面积图(Area Chart)因其直观展示数据变化趋势的能力,广泛应用于商业、科研、教育等各个领域。其中,Excel作为最常用的工具,其面积图功能已经非常成熟。但
2026-01-23 00:09:58
55人看过
热门推荐
热门专题:
资讯中心: